Binance and Changpeng Zhao Win Dismissal of $4.3B Terrorism Financing Civil Lawsuit
RegulationAnti-Terrorism ActBinancechangpeng zhaocrypto regulationCryptocurrency LawsuitCZFederal Court RulingTerrorism Financing
TLDR: Binance and founder Changpeng Zhao had all civil terrorism financing claims dismissed by a Manhattan federal judge. The 535 plaintiffs failed to prove Binance culpably linked itself to 64 terrorist attacks from 2017 to 2024. Judge Vargas ruled the 891-page complaint was excessive but allowed plaintiffs to file an amended version. Zhao accused plaintiffs [...]
